(Nov 9, 2015, 14:53)Freeman Wrote:  So nice...what is it though...? Keep posting your fantastic bird shots! Jeff

This is a Northern Shrike Jeff - a predatory songbird that breeds in taiga and tundra and winters in southern Canada and the northern United States.
